Adventure in Bali

Wednesday, August 30: Ubud

Start your adventure in the cultural heart of Bali, Ubud. In the morning, explore the lush green rice terraces of Tegalalang and immerse yourself in the tranquility of nature. Afternoon can be spent at Campuhan Ridge Walk, a scenic trail offering panoramic views of the surrounding hills and forests. As the evening sets in, visit the Ubud Monkey Forest, where you can interact with playful monkeys amidst ancient temples.

  • Tegalalang Rice Terraces: Estimated cost - INR 200,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Campuhan Ridge Walk: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Ubud Monkey Forest: Estimated cost - INR 80, Time spent - 1-2 hours
Thursday, August 31: Mount Batur

Embark on a thrilling sunrise trek to Mount Batur, an active volcano. Early morning, begin your ascent to the summit and witness the breathtaking sunrise over the surrounding landscapes. After descending, rejuvenate yourself with a dip in the natural hot springs of Toya Devasya. In the evening, explore the nearby village of Kintamani and indulge in delicious local cuisine.

  • Mount Batur Sunrise Trek: Estimated cost - INR 2000, Time spent - 8-10 hours
  • Toya Devasya Hot Springs: Estimated cost - INR 500,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Kintamani Village: Estimated cost - INR 500, Time spent - 1-2 hours
Friday, September 1: Nusa Penida

Take a day trip to the stunning island of Nusa Penida. Begin by visiting the iconic Kelingking Beach, known for its dramatic cliffs and crystal-clear turquoise waters. Afterward, head to Broken Beach to witness the natural arch formation and the breathtaking ocean view. Conclude your day with a visit to Angel's Billabong, a natural infinity pool carved out of limestone.

  • Kelingking Beach: Estimated cost - INR 1000 (including boat transfer), Time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Broken Beach: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1 hour
  • Angel's Billabong: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1 hour
Saturday, September 2: Telaga Waja River Rafting

Embark on an exhilarating white water rafting adventure at Telaga Waja River. Enjoy the thrill of navigating through the rapids, surrounded by lush jungles and cascading waterfalls. After the thrilling activity, visit the ancient Goa Lawah Temple, known as the Bat Cave Temple, which is built around a cave inhabited by bats.

  • Telaga Waja River Rafting: Estimated cost - INR 2500, Time spent - 4-5 hours
  • Goa Lawah Temple: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1 hour
Sunday, September 3: Tanah Lot

Visit the famous sea temple of Tanah Lot, perched on a rock formation surrounded by the Indian Ocean. In the morning, explore the temple complex and enjoy the stunning coastal views. Afternoon can be spent at nearby Echo Beach, a popular surfing spot with a relaxed vibe. As the sun begins to set, witness the magical sight of Tanah Lot temple against the backdrop of a fiery sunset.

  • Tanah Lot Temple: Estimated cost - INR 100,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Echo Beach: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Monday, September 4: Tegenungan Waterfall

Discover the beauty of Tegenungan Waterfall, nestled amidst lush greenery. In the morning, hike down to the waterfall's base and take a refreshing dip in its cool waters. Afterward, visit the Bali Swing, an adrenaline-pumping activity that allows you to swing over lush valleys and rice fields. End your day with a visit to the Goa Gajah Temple, also known as the Elephant Cave.

  • Tegenungan Waterfall: Estimated cost - INR 100,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Bali Swing: Estimated cost - INR 1500,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Goa Gajah Temple: Estimated cost - INR 50, Time spent - 1 hour
Tuesday, September 5: Seminyak

Head to the trendy beach town of Seminyak for a day of relaxation and exploration. Morning can be spent sunbathing on the golden sands of Seminyak Beach. In the afternoon, indulge in some retail therapy at the stylish boutiques and art galleries of Seminyak's shopping district. As the evening sets in, enjoy a delicious dinner at one of the beachfront restaurants and witness a vibrant sunset.

  • Seminyak Beach: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Seminyak Shopping District: Estimated cost - Variable,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Beachfront Dinner: Estimated cost - INR 1000, Time spent - 2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For adventure seekers, Bali offers some off the beaten path attractions and activities. Explore the lesser-known Gitgit Waterfall in the north of Bali, surrounded by lush forests and a serene atmosphere. Dive into the underwater world by snorkeling or diving in the pristine waters of Menjangan Island, known for its vibrant coral reefs and marine life. For a unique experience, hike to the secluded Banyumala Twin Waterfalls and enjoy the tranquility of nature.
